Output 5acb32a9a78829c3407d8a5a80e6e5f83f5fcab7e6679a434c3b255f81e81fc2:1

value
396507598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8d5188af189073e27103a64e83462809c02f2fb OP_EQUALVERIFY OP_CHECKSIG
address
DQubmrWa8eCmEs2dWGoEHPfrDezQ1PUTTZ
transaction
5acb32a9a78829c3407d8a5a80e6e5f83f5fcab7e6679a434c3b255f81e81fc2